New TV Commercial "The Responsibility of Politics" Targeted at Lower House Election Announced


At a press conference at party headquarters on the afternoon of November 21, DPJ Secretary General Yukio Hatoyama announced the release of a new TV commercial, "The Responsibility of Politics," targeted at the dissolution of the House of Representatives and a general election. (see link below for the new commercial)The new commercial started to air nationwide on November 22.

Hatoyama explained once again, "We have been pressing that the [Aso] cabinet ought to go through election [for its legitimacy], and we will stick to that." He declared that as opposed to the Aso government, the DPJ has acted in recognition that politics is of course all about improving the lives of citizens: "Putting people's lives first" and "Politics is about people's lives." Hatoyama disclosed that some of DPJ President Ozawa's work of walking in every part of the country and listening to people in-person was used to make the commercial. He added, "Knowing that we are the party that can reliably carry out the responsibility of politics, we are moving to accomplish a change in government. We want people to feel that enthusiasm."

The new commercial portrays the DPJ as being able to carry out "The Responsibility of Politics," while the LDP-New Komeito ruling coalition, despite being confronted with an unprecedented crisis in the world economy, is still not taking people's lives into consideration, raising fears that politics will continue being unable to function.
